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Missing font updates #1746

Open
Finii opened this issue Nov 19, 2024 · 4 comments
Open

Missing font updates #1746

Finii opened this issue Nov 19, 2024 · 4 comments

Comments

@Finii
Copy link
Collaborator

Finii commented Nov 19, 2024

Just a quick, naive question if you have time: I'm curious why
aren't the latest versions of some fonts pulled before being patched
with the NF glyphs?

Originally posted by @redactedscribe in #1742 (comment)

  • Cascadia
  • Geist Mono
  • Inconsolata LGC
  • Iosevka
  • Lilex
  • Ubuntu Sans

did not check Noto

@Finii
Copy link
Collaborator Author

Finii commented Nov 19, 2024

Original Font Name our ver upstream ver
0xProto 2.201
3270 3.0.1
Agave 37
Anonymous Pro 1.002
Arimo 1.33
Aurulent Sans Mono (Stephen G. Hartke)
BigBlueTerminal (VileR)
Vera Sans Mono (Bitstream Inc) 1.1
IBM Plex Mono 2.004
Cascadia Code 2111.01 2404.23 🟠
Cascadia Mono 2111.01 2404.23 🟠
Code New Roman (Sam Radian) 2.0
Comic Shanns Mono 1.3.1
Commit Mono 1.143
Cousine 1.211
D2Coding 1.3.2
DaddyTimeMono 1.2.3
Departure Mono 1.422
DejaVu 2.37
Droid Sans Mono (Ascender Corp) 1.00-113
Envy Code R 0.79
Fantasque Sans Mono 1.8.0
Fira Code 6.2
Fira Mono 3.206
Geist Mono 1.200 1.4.01 🟠
Go-Mono 2.010
Gohu TTF 2.0
Hack 3.003
Hasklig 1.2
HeavyData (Vic Fieger) 1
Hermit 2.0
iA-Writer Dec 2018
Inconsolata 3.000 3.100 in repo unreleased
InconsolataGo 1.013
Inconsolata LGC 1.5.2 1.9.0 🟠
Intel One Mono 1.4.0
Iosevka 29.0.4 32.1.0 🟠
Iosevka Term 29.0.4 32.1.0 🟠
Iosevka Term Slab 29.0.4 32.1.0 🟠
JetBrains Mono 2.304
Lekton 34
Liberation 2.1.5
Lilex 2.400 2.600 🟠
MartianMono 1.0.0
Meslo 1.21
Monaspace 1.101
Monofur (Tobias B Koehler) 1.0
Monoid 0.61
Mononoki 1.6
MPlus Fonts 2023/09
Noto div
OpenDyslexic 2.001
Overpass 3.0.5
ProFont 2.3, 2.2
ProggyClean (Tristan Grimmer) 2004/04/15
Recursive Mono 1.085
Roboto Mono 3.0
Source Code Pro 2.042
Share Tech Mono 1.003
Space Mono 1.001
Terminus TTF 4.49.3
Tinos 1.23
Ubuntu Font 0.83
Ubuntu Font 0.80
Ubuntu Sans 1.004 1.006 🟠
Victor Mono 1.5.6
Zed Mono 1.2.0

@harg
Copy link

harg commented Nov 24, 2024

On google font, Inconsolata is at version 3.001.

Is it also possible to add all variants :
image
...

Thanks!

@Finii
Copy link
Collaborator Author

Finii commented Nov 25, 2024

On google font, Inconsolata is at version 3.001.

image

@Finii
Copy link
Collaborator Author

Finii commented Nov 25, 2024

Hmm, the font files are 3.1.
Differing glyphs are shown with this green (?) mark but even close visual inspection did not come up with anything It is possibly minuscule changes because they changed to a VF and created the instances from that.
I usually expect projects to release a font before it is used as source here. Anyhow, changed the table above.

For the variantions, we could add some selected weights or styles, but all is a bit too much which will never be used.

image

Edit

Hmm there seem to be multiple issues with 3.100: https://github.com/googlefonts/Inconsolata/issues
Maybe that is the reason it has not been released. I guess we should not update unless the more problematic ones are solved.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ants